As a leading figure in the Washington Color School, Gene Davis (1920–1985) explored the psychological impact of color through precise, vertical stripes. "Homage to Matisse" reflects his fascination with chromatic intensity and optical vibration, created during a period when artists sought to push abstraction beyond traditional boundaries. This print offers a glimpse into mid-century modern art, where color itself becomes the subject, inviting viewers into a dynamic visual experience.

What is the historical significance of "Homage to Matisse" by Gene Davis?

Created in 1960, this work reflects Gene Davis's role in the Washington Color School, using bold stripes to pay tribute to Henri Matisse's color innovations, highlighting mid-century American abstraction.

How does Gene Davis's technique influence the visual effect of this print?

Davis's precise vertical stripes create optical vibration and chromatic intensity, captured in this reproduction to evoke the dynamic energy of 1960s Color Field painting.
